Output efda3a2dcce14b725b19ebd908c0c25144a7b78b6c47eaf2fddb58e2a18a5c96:1

value
10434980507
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d7212f4af4ecdba5afbdec2957a1ba29682215852b92e0d86bd4e30d54638634
address
tb1p6usj7jh5and6ttaaas540gd6995zy9v99wfwpkrt6n3s64rrsc6qqwv4ke
transaction
efda3a2dcce14b725b19ebd908c0c25144a7b78b6c47eaf2fddb58e2a18a5c96
confirmations
16498
spent
true